Forum

Mac IDE att använda för C++ på M1 Mac

G

gloryofgreece

Originalaffisch
6 februari 2008
seattle
  • 12 juni 2021
Jag är ny ägare av M1 Mac Mini. Jag lär mig bara lite C++-programmering och ibland leetcoding. Jag märkte att man inte kan använda code::blocks på m1 inbyggt och jag tycker att eclipse/vs community är lite för tungt för det jag jobbar med. xcode är riktigt komplicerat.

För C++-proffs på den här communityn, vilken IDE använder du på dina m1-mackar?

casperes 1996

26 januari 2014


Horsens, Danmark
  • 12 juni 2021
Inte i sig IDE utan beroende på situation; visuell studiokod, nano/vim och jetbrains. Jag kommer också att använda Xcode för att redigera då och då, men oftast använder jag bara Xcode för swift
Reaktioner:BigMcGuire och TiggrToo jag

ipxsystems

29 december 2005
  • 17 juni 2021
Ännu en röst på VSC. DE

fredsskapande

10 maj 2009
Des Moines, WA
  • 17 juni 2021
Terminal.app och BBEdit anropade från den; så ingen IDE egentligen

TiggrToo

24 augusti 2017
Där ute... långt där ute
  • 17 juni 2021
casperes1996 sa: Inte i sig IDE utan beroende på situation; visuell studiokod, nano/vim och jetbrains. Jag kommer också att använda Xcode för att redigera då och då, men oftast använder jag bara Xcode för swift
Vi tycker likadant. VSCode och JetBrains är båda i stort sett alltid igång, och jag har varit en vi-användare sedan 1990-talet!
Reaktioner:BigMcGuire DE

fredsskapande

10 maj 2009
Des Moines, WA
  • 17 juni 2021
Xcode, gör de svåra sakerna lättare och de enkla sakerna svåra!

Om du lär dig C/C++/Swift-språk och inte lär dig en 'plattform' prova en onlineredigerare, kompilator och körmiljö i stil med ...

< https://rextester.com/l/cpp_online_compiler_clang >

Det finns många sådana onlineresurser. Senast redigerad: 17 juni 2021

casperes 1996

26 januari 2014
Horsens, Danmark
  • 17 juni 2021
TiggrToo sa: Vi tycker likadant. VSCode och JetBrains är båda i stort sett alltid igång, och jag har varit en vi-användare sedan 1990-talet!

Är det nu vi dunk på emacs-folket?
Reaktioner:BigMcGuire

sgtaylor5

Bidragsgivare
6 augusti 2017
Cheney, WA, USA
  • 17 juni 2021
Viper är ett Vi-emuleringspaket för Emacs. DE

fredsskapande

10 maj 2009
Des Moines, WA
  • 17 juni 2021
Nytt i Xcode 13
Inställningar → Textredigering → Redigering → Aktivera Vim-tangentbindningar

casperes 1996

26 januari 2014
Horsens, Danmark
  • 18 juni 2021
lloyddean sa: Nytt i Xcode 13
Inställningar → Textredigering → Redigering → Aktivera Vim-tangentbindningar
Ja. Om någon däremot läser detta och tänker Vad är vim? Ska jag aktivera detta?... Gör det inte. Vim är cool och allt, men om du inte redan vet hur man använder det kommer det att förvirra byxorna av dig, när du försöker knyta d20 som ett variabelnamn i din app för tärningsrullning, och 20 rader kod försvinner, haha S

Mr Cuete

9 november 2011
  • 18 juni 2021
gloryofgreece sa: Jag är ny ägare till M1 Mac Mini. Jag lär mig bara lite C++-programmering och ibland leetcoding. Jag märkte att man inte kan använda code::blocks på m1 inbyggt och jag tycker att eclipse/vs community är lite för tungt för det jag jobbar med. xcode är riktigt komplicerat.

För C++-proffs på den här communityn, vilken IDE använder du på dina m1-mackar?
Detta visar ett viktigt faktum: att lära sig vilket språk/IDE är en enorm investering i tid, med en brant inlärningskurva. Att byta till en ny är en stor uppgift. Av denna anledning kommer folk alltid att säga till dig att den som de känner är fantastisk. Ramar som kakao är mycket kraftfulla och även komplexa. Om du tar dig tid att lära dig XCode / Cocoa kommer du att behärska din Mac fullständigt, men det här är mycket att lära. DE

fredsskapande

10 maj 2009
Des Moines, WA
  • 18 juni 2021
Senor Cuete sa: Detta visar ett viktigt faktum: att lära sig vilket språk/IDE är en enorm investering i tid, med en brant inlärningskurva. Att byta till en ny är en stor uppgift. Av denna anledning kommer folk alltid att säga till dig att den som de känner är fantastisk. Ramar som kakao är mycket kraftfulla och även komplexa. Om du tar dig tid att lära dig XCode / Cocoa kommer du att behärska din Mac fullständigt, men det här är mycket att lära.

Speciellt med tanke på det sorgliga läget för Apple Documentation för närvarande. S

Mr Cuete

9 november 2011
  • 18 juni 2021
Ja lloydean och det gick verkligen neråt när Apple bestämde sig för att uppfinna Swift. DE

fredsskapande

10 maj 2009
Des Moines, WA
  • 19 juni 2021
Senor Cuete sa: Ja lloydean och det gick verkligen neråt när Apple bestämde sig för att uppfinna Swift.

Det kommer att ske efter ett hemligt beslut att skriva om och implementera API:erna för applikationsutveckling på ett helt nytt språk.

Såg det komma när Swift tillkännagavs och lite eller ingen uppdaterad dokumentation dök upp men det dämpar inte smärtan.

casperes 1996

26 januari 2014
Horsens, Danmark
  • 19 juni 2021
lloyddean sa: Det kommer att hända efter ett hemligt beslut att skriva om och implementera API:erna för applikationsutveckling på ett helt nytt språk.

Såg det komma när Swift tillkännagavs och lite eller ingen uppdaterad dokumentation dök upp men det dämpar inte smärtan.

Dokumentationen som finns tillgänglig för några av de nyare Swift-grejerna är också riktigt bra. Även om det fortfarande finns många saker som saknas, har det som har åtföljt de nuvarande iterationerna av SwiftUI varit riktigt utmärkt dokumentation DE

fredsskapande

10 maj 2009
Des Moines, WA
  • 19 juni 2021
casperes1996 sa: Dokumentationen som är tillgänglig för några av de nyare Swift-grejerna är också riktigt bra. Även om det fortfarande finns många saker som saknas, har det som har åtföljt de nuvarande iterationerna av SwiftUI varit riktigt utmärkt dokumentation
Håller med, och det ser lovande ut.